One of the oldest known photographs of the Holy Kaaba is believed to date back to around 1880 (1297 AH), making the remarkable image approximately 146 years old.
The historic photograph is widely attributed to Ottoman-Egyptian engineer and photographer Muhammad Sadiq Bey, who is recognized for capturing some of the earliest known photographs of Makkah and the sacred sites during the late 19th century. His pioneering work provided a rare visual record of the Holy City at a time when photography was still in its infancy.
These early images offer a unique glimpse into the historical landscape of Makkah, preserving scenes of the Holy Kaaba and its surroundings long before the era of modern development and expansion. Today, such photographs remain invaluable historical documents, helping scholars and historians better understand the architectural and cultural heritage of Islamβs holiest site.
More than a century later, these rare photographs continue to inspire fascination around the world, serving as a powerful reminder of the enduring spiritual significance and timeless legacy of the Holy Kaaba.
